bpp-phyl  2.2.0
bpp::PhylogeneticsApplicationTools Member List

This is the complete list of members for bpp::PhylogeneticsApplicationTools, including all inherited members.

checkEstimatedParameters(const ParameterList &pl)bpp::PhylogeneticsApplicationToolsstatic
completeMixedSubstitutionModelSet(MixedSubstitutionModelSet &mixedModelSet, const Alphabet *alphabet, const SiteContainer *data, std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getFrequenciesSet(const Alphabet *alphabet, const GeneticCode *gCode, const std::string &freqDescription, const SiteContainer *data, const std::vector< double > &rateFreqs,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getMultipleDistributionDefaultInstance(const std::string &distDescription, std::map< std::string, std::string > &unparsedParameterValues, bool verbose=true)bpp::PhylogeneticsApplicationToolsstatic
getRateDistribution(std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true)bpp::PhylogeneticsApplicationToolsstatic
getRootFrequenciesSet(const Alphabet *alphabet, const GeneticCode *gCode, const SiteContainer *data, std::map< std::string, std::string > &params, const std::vector< double > &rateFreqs,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ionCount(const Alphabet *alphabet, const SubstitutionModel *model, map< string, string > &params, string suffix="", b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ionModel(const Alphabet *alphabet, const GeneticCode *gCode, const SiteContainer *data, std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getSubstitutionModelSet(const Alphabet *alphabet, const GeneticCode *gcode, const SiteContainer *data, std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getTree(std::map< std::string, std::string > &params, const std::string &prefix="input.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
getTrees(std::map< std::string, std::string > &params, const std::string &prefix="input.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
optimizeParameters(TreeLikelihood *tl, const ParameterList &parameters, std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
optimizeParameters(DiscreteRatesAcrossSitesClockTreeLikelihood *tl, const ParameterList &parameters, std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
PhylogeneticsApplicationTools()bpp::PhylogeneticsApplicationTools
printParameters(const SubstitutionModel *model, OutputStream &out,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const SubstitutionModelSet *modelSet, OutputStream &out,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
printParameters(const DiscreteDistribution *rDist, OutputStream &out)bpp::PhylogeneticsApplicationToolsstatic
setSubstitutionModelParametersInitialValuesWithAliases(SubstitutionModel &model, std::map< std::string, std::string > &unparsedParameterValues, size_t modelNumber, const SiteContainer *data, std::map< std::string, double > &existingParams, std::map< std::string, std::string > &sharedParams, bool verbose)bpp::PhylogeneticsApplicationToolsstatic
setSubstitutionModelSet(SubstitutionModelSet &modelSet, const Alphabet *alphabet, const GeneticCode *gcode, const SiteContainer *data, std::map< std::string, std::string > &params, const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
writeTree(const TreeTemplate< Node > &tree, std::map< std::string, std::string > &params, const std::string &prefix="output.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, bool checkOnly=false,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
writeTrees(const std::vector< Tree *> &trees, std::map< std::string, std::string > &params, const std::string &prefix="output.", const std::string &suffix="", bool suffixIsOptional=true, bool verbose=true, bool checkOnly=false, int warn=1)bpp::PhylogeneticsApplicationToolsstatic
~PhylogeneticsApplicationTools()bpp::PhylogeneticsApplicationToolsvirtual